Mastering Laravel Development: From Beginner to Expert

Embark on a journey to master the world of Laravel development. Whether you're a complete novice or have some prior experience, this comprehensive guide will equip you with the knowledge and skills needed to build robust and scalable web applications. We'll delve into the core concepts of Laravel, diving into its powerful features and intuitive syntax. From routing and controllers to databases and models, you'll gain a deep understanding of how Laravel works under the hood.

  • We'll start with the basics, demonstrating essential concepts like MVC architecture and package management.
  • As you progress, we'll address more advanced topics such as API development, testing, and deployment.
  • Throughout the course, you'll design real-world projects that highlight your increasing Laravel expertise.

Ultimately, this guide aims to empower you into a skilled Laravel developer, ready to take on any web development challenge with confidence.

Crafting Robust APIs with Laravel Framework

Laravel's user-friendly nature makes it a prime choice for building robust and scalable APIs. Leveraging its extensive features, developers can efficiently create well-structured APIs that adhere to best practices. Laravel's built-in tools for routing provide a clear and concise way to define API endpoints. Its robust controller system allows click here for clean separation of concerns, while its flexible middleware can be used to authorize requests effectively.

Furthermore, Laravel's well-integrated ecosystem offers a plethora of extensions specifically designed for API development. These packages provide off-the-shelf solutions for common API tasks such as data transformation, user management, and more. By embracing these tools, developers can accelerate the API development process, resulting in robust and maintainable APIs that meet the demands of modern applications.

Harnessing the Power of PHP Laravel for Web Applications

PHP Laravel has emerged as a dominant framework in the world of web development, empowering developers to build robust and scalable applications with efficiency. Its extensive ecosystem provides a vast array of tools and libraries that optimize the development process. From routing and templating to database management and authentication, Laravel offers integrated solutions that boost development time.

  • Additionally, Laravel's elegant syntax makes it accessible to developers of all skill levels.
  • As a result, numerous businesses and organizations worldwide are utilizing Laravel to build high-performance web applications that meet the demands of today's digital landscape.

Unlocking the Potential of Laravel API Documentation

Leveraging comprehensive API documentation is crucial for developers working with Laravel applications. Well-structured documentation empowers teams to effectively build, maintain, and understand APIs. By crafting accessible descriptions, examples, and code snippets, developers can create a valuable resource that streamlines the development process.

A robust API documentation strategy involves several key elements:

  • Focusing on clear API endpoints and their functionalities.
  • Implementing code samples that demonstrate common use cases.
  • Refining documentation to reflect changes in the Laravel framework or application.
  • Harnessing version control systems to track revisions and ensure consistency.

By allocating time and effort into API documentation, developers can unlock its immense potential for collaboration, knowledge sharing, and ultimately, the success of their Laravel projects.

Crafting Scalable and Protected Applications with Laravel

Laravel has emerged as a popular PHP framework for building sophisticated software. Its component-based architecture, coupled with a extensive ecosystem of tools and libraries, empowers developers to craft applications that are both efficient and defensible.

At its core, Laravel's philosophy centers around usability, allowing developers to focus their time on building core functionality rather than wrestling with complex technical details.

  • Adhering to industry-standard security practices is paramount when developing web applications. Laravel provides a range of built-in features that help mitigate common vulnerabilities, such as SQL injection and cross-site scripting (XSS).
  • Thorough input validation is crucial for ensuring data integrity and preventing malicious attacks. Laravel's validation system provides a flexible and powerful way to validate user input, enforcing specific criteria.
  • Authentication mechanisms are fundamental for protecting sensitive resources and governing user access. Laravel offers a flexible authentication system that can be tailored to meet the individual demands of your application.

Utilizing Laravel's extensive capabilities allows developers to construct scalable and secure applications with confidence. By adhering to best practices and implementing the security features provided by Laravel, you can minimize vulnerabilities and ensure the integrity of your web application.

Modern Web Development with Laravel: A Comprehensive Guide

Laravel has emerged as a popular framework for crafting modern web applications. Its user-friendly syntax and rich ecosystem of tools empower developers to develop robust, scalable, and secure applications with ease. This comprehensive guide delves into the core concepts of Laravel, equipping you with the knowledge and skills required to embark on your web development journey. From basic routing and templating to advanced features like migrations and authentication, we'll explore every aspect that makes Laravel a preferred choice for developers worldwide.

  • Dive into the fundamentals of Laravel framework
  • Learn routing, controllers, and models
  • Utilize database migrations for seamless data management
  • Build secure authentication systems for your applications
  • Leverage the power of Blade templating engine for dynamic content generation

Whether you're a novice or an experienced developer looking to enhance your skillset, this guide provides a clear and concise roadmap to mastering Laravel. Get ready to unlock the potential of this versatile framework and craft modern web applications that are both functional and engaging.

Leave a Reply

Your email address will not be published. Required fields are marked *